My family is looking at booking a package trip for May 2017 (our first trip in several years). I'm considering upgrading my husband's ticket to an annual pass. My reasoning is that between being able to purchase the Tables in Wonderland card, and getting Memory Maker for free, plus merchandise discounts, our savings would break even with the cost of upgrading. We live on the west coast and are not planning another trip within a year, but who knows? If the cost is the same, why not just in case?


So, question #1. CAN an individual upgrade a package ticket to an AP if the rest of the group in the package isn’t?


#2. What are the pros and cons (if any) to upgrading before the trip versus when we first arrive?


If we decided to take a 2nd trip, we’d book the room (possibly with an AP discount) separate from the rest of the group’s tickets.


#3. If we received a Bounceback offer, would it be likely to be better than an AP room discount?


#4. Do Bouncebacks usually require a package purchase, or are they often room-only?


This is when my thinking got CRAZY!! WHAT IF a package offer was the best deal for our family for the 2nd trip? For instance, if (either through a Bounceback or general public offer), free dining was offered for when we wanted to go? (With a large family who likes a value resort (AofA), free dining would be a Huge savings.)


#5. Can an AP holder be part of a package (understanding that they would have to purchase tickets like everyone else)?


And if yes, #6. What would happen to those tickets? When my husband goes through the turnstyle, would the multi-day ticket be used, or would it just use the annual pass?


#7. What happens to a package ticket that is never used? Does it stay on the account and can be used later? Does it expire?


Also, are there any other aspects to this that I haven’t mentioned, but should be considered?


Feel free to answer just one or a few questions. Also feel free to pick apart my thinking. I appreciate your knowledge and insights!
 
#1, I don't see why not.
#2, If you have a package you probably can't upgrade before the trip, so this may be a non-issue. We had to upgrade in person at Guest Services.
#3, Who knows. AP discounts are VERY limited (dates & resorts).
#4, They usually have both, but not at the same time (some dates are a room deal, some are free dining with ticket purchase required)
#5, Yes, and you can use those (unused) tickets towards the cost of renewing your AP, or just save them for another trip.
#6, You should go to Guest Services to have them prioritized to be sure the correct ticket us being used.
#7, They didn't use to expire, but that could change at any time. Even if it does "expire" Disney usually has wording to the effct of "you can use this at it's cash value toward another ticket purchase" so you'll just pay the difference in cost.
